Understanding Git
Git is a version control system that helps developers manage code changes. It allows teams to collaborate efficiently and track modifications in the codebase.
Key Features of Git
Version tracking
Branching and merging
Collaboration support
Why Git is Important
Git ensures that developers can work on the same project without conflicts. It also helps in maintaining a history of changes, making it easier to fix bugs.
Understanding Jenkins
Jenkins is a popular automation tool used for Continuous Integration and Continuous Deployment (CI/CD). It automates the process of building, testing, and deploying applications.
Key Features of Jenkins
Automation of workflows
Integration with multiple tools
Plugin support
Benefits of Jenkins
Reduces manual work
Speeds up development
Improves code quality
Understanding Docker
Docker is a containerization platform that packages applications along with their dependencies. This ensures that applications run consistently across different environments.
Key Features of Docker
Lightweight containers
Portability
Fast deployment
Benefits of Docker
Eliminates environment issues
Simplifies deployment
Improves scalability
How These Tools Work Together
Git manages code changes
Jenkins automates build and deployment
Docker ensures consistent environments
Together, they create a smooth DevOps workflow.
Real-World Example
A developer writes code and pushes it to Git. Jenkins detects the change, builds the application, and runs tests. Docker packages the application into a container and deploys it. This entire process happens automatically.
